QUESTION NO. 24
QUESTION: Councillor Shane Moynihan
To ask the Chief Executive as to what pre-planning consultation or contact took place with the planning department pertaining to the proposed development at the old Foxhunter site in Lucan and if he will make a statement on the matter.
REPLY:
Planning reference SD20A/0259 relates to lands adjacent to Foxhunter Pub, Ballydowd, Lucan, Co. Dublin. This is an ongoing planning application with a decision due date of 9th December 2020.
The proposal is described in the public notices as
(a) Formation of a new vehicular, cycle and pedestrian entrance off Hermitage Gardens to the west of the site and two pedestrian/cycle entrances to the north of the site off the N4; (b) construction of a semi-basemen/full basement car park for 97 cars, bin and bicycle storage and plantrooms, with two-way access ramp; (c) construction of a 1.2m high (approximately) raised podium over the car park area; (d) a four-storey above podium apartment block containing 15 apartments; (e) a three-storey apartment block (A) containing 21 apartments and a 15.12sq.m substation at ground floor; (f) a three-storey apartment block (B) containing 21 apartments; (g) a twenty storey above podium apartment building containing 104 apartments, entrance lobby, communal facilities including work stations, meeting rooms, laundry and office and external podium level terrace; (h) 328 bicycle parking places dispersed throughout, underground rainwater retention tanks; hard and soft landscaping, including planted communal gardens and play areas; pedestrian and cycle access/egress only will be retained off the N4; the mix of the apartments will be as follows: 37 studio apartments, 42 1-bed apartments, 8 2-bedroom (3 person) apartments, 70 2-bedroom (4 person) apartments, 4 3-bed apartments; total number of apartments proposed is 161; 67% of the apartments will be dual aspect and all will have balconies or private open space; all buildings will have roof plantrooms, green roofs and photovoltaic panels.
The Planning Authority does not have a recorded pre planning for the subject site for a residential proposal. It is also noted that the applicant has indicated that no pre planning was carried in Question 19 of the planning application form.
